Pitching coach Dave Bush said Wednesday that Brasier has still not cleared concussion protocols after being hit in the head June 4, Jen McCaffrey of The Athletic reports.
EDGE Analysis
Brasier resumed baseball activities in late June, but per Bush, he's yet to throw off a mound as he continues to be monitored for his concussion. It sounds like he'll be limited to ground work until he's officially out of the concussion protocol, which means he's likely multiple weeks to a month from being able to return to the Boston bullpen.

Brasier (concussion) was cleared to play catch and resume baseball activities Saturday, Chris Cotillo of The Springfield Republican reports.
EDGE Analysis
Brasier has been on the injured list since late March due to a calf strain, but he was shut down in early June and diagnosed with a concussion after he was hit in the side of the head by a line drive during a simulated game. The right-hander had been nearing his return to Boston's bullpen prior to his three-week shutdown, but it's not yet clear when he'll be able to return to game action at this point.

Brasier (calf) is now dealing with a concussion and a cut above his ear after Friday's comebacker incident, Pete Abraham of The Boston Globe reports.
EDGE Analysis
The reliever is now resting at home after the scary incident in Friday's simulated game, when he took a line drive to the head and required an overnight stay in the hospital. The concussion comes at an extremely unfortunate time for Brasier, as he was nearing his return to the Boston bullpen.

The Red Sox transferred Brasier (calf) to the 60-day injured list Monday.
EDGE Analysis
The transaction clears a spot on the 40-man roster for reliever Brandon Brennan, who was claimed off waivers from Seattle and optioned to Triple-A Worcester. Brasier picked up a calf strain late in spring training and recently began a throwing program, but he's not on track to complete his progression until the second half of the month. He should be ready to go around the time he's first eligible to return from the 60-day IL in early June.
